Required Skills: •Design, build, and maintain automated deployment pipelines for application code, database schema changes, and environment updates across production and non-production systems. •Develop and maintain configuration management automation (e.g., Ansible) so configuration changes are consistent, auditable, and repeatable across the fleet. •Build and extend infrastructure-as-code (e.g., Terraform, CloudFormation) so environments can be provisioned, changed, and torn down predictably rather than by hand. •Build and improve CI/CD pipelines that move code and configuration through test, approval, and production stages with appropriate gates and rollback paths. •Identify manual, repetitive operational work, prioritize it by time saved and risk reduced, and convert it into automation with measurable results reported back to the team. •Partner with the operations team to root cause automation-related incidents and close the gap between documented procedure and actual system behavior. •Document automation design decisions and operating procedures so the work is maintainable by others and not dependent on any one person. Qualifications: •Working proficiency with a configuration management tool such as Ansible. •Scripting proficiency in Python, Bash, or PowerShell, with the judgment to know when a manual process should become code. •Solid functional working knowledge of AWS cloud environments. •Clear, direct communication and the ability to explain a technical tradeoff to both engineers and non-engineers. •Exposure to Progress OpenEdge (PASOE) application server environments and observability tooling (e.g., Dynatrace, Elastic, PagerDuty) is a plus. •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Technology, or equivalent experience.
